Default Michelle lakes and the Ram river trout slam

Well we got ourselves up to Michelle lakes for the Golden trout opener and simply an overall WOW factor.
Weather was great, scenery was awesome and those Golden trout are simply beautiful and plentiful.
Then it was off to the Ram river and again the same as the Michelle lakes weather wise and scenery but the west slope cut throat are much bigger but not as pretty.
Great week fly fishing and just enjoying the great outdoors!

It’s been about 19years since I did a trip to Michelle lakes. It was definitely a trip worth doing for the experience

The males are definitely nice looking but the fish are not very big. If I remember right the biggest I caught over 4 days was just under 14inches

I don’t know about your trip but when I went there with 2 buddies it was actually pretty busy with other fishermen considering the location
